In experimental and applied particle physics, nuclear physics, and nuclear engineering, a particle detector, also known as a radiation detector, is a device used to detect, track, and/or identify ionizing particles, such as those produced by nuclear decay, cosmic radiation, or reactions in a particle accelerator. WebA particle detector is a device built to observe and identify particles. Some measure photons, particles of light such as the visible light from stars or the invisible X-rays we use to examine broken bones. Other particle detectors identify protons, neutrons and electrons—the particles that make up atoms—or even entire atoms.
